About this document

This document describes the procedure for installing an I/O module 

into an HP StorageWorks MSA2000 3.5 12-drive enclosure. 

IMPORTANT: 

Install this module only into an MSA2000 3.5 

12-drive enclosure.

CAUTION: 

Parts can be damaged by electrostatic discharge. 

Use proper anti-static protection.

Keep the replacement component in the ESD bag until needed.

Wear an ESD wrist strap grounded to an unpainted surface of 

the chassis.

If an ESD wrist strap is unavailable, touch an unpainted surface 

of the chassis before handling the component.

Never touch connector pins.

Removing the air management blank

CAUTION: 

When upgrading an existing operational system 

with an I/O module, removing the blank impacts the airflow and 

cooling ability of the device. To avoid possible overheating, insert 

the I/O module as quickly as possible. If the internal temperature 

exceeds acceptable limits, the enclosure may overheat and 

automatically shut down or restart.

NOTE: 

For clarity, only relevant details are shown in these 

illustrations.

1.

Turn the thumbscrews until the screws disengage from the blank.

2.

Press both latches downward.

3.

Pull the blank straight out of the enclosure.
